To access this program: To access the program, type HISTDISP (RET) at any menu "OPTION:" field or the appropriate number on the History/Maintenance Menu.vehicle record:
Press "F6" key to search the vehicle history records. The search will display as follows:

Select:
F1 - search by vehicle number. If more than one vehicle exists with the same unit number, all units on file with the matching unit number will be listed. Select the unit desired.
F2 - search by service code or by service code and vehicle number
F3 - search by license plate number
F4 - limit the search by status (Open, Closed, or All history records)
F5 - search by the P.O. (Purchase Order number).
F6 - change the display so that the search begins with the most recent record and goes back to the oldest record. (Default is to begin with the oldest record and come forward to the most recent.)
Example:
Research when the most recent oil change was done on a vehicle.
Press F6 to change the order to "2" Current.
Press F2. Enter the Service Code number for the oil change, press (RET), enter the vehicle number, press (RET).
All oil change records for the vehicle will display beginning with the most recent record.
If an attempt is made to edit the data on the screen, when F1 is pressed the following message will display:
RECORDS CANNOT BE EDITED WITH THIS PGM;USE VEHICLE HISTORY UPDATE
